c语言第一个基础代码怎么写步骤

admin C语言 4


刚接触 C 语言的小白,是不是打开编译器后,对着空白的界面就发懵?想写第一个代码,却不知道从哪儿下手?别慌,兔子哥这就带你一步步写出属于你的第一个 C 语言代码,超级详细,保证你能看懂、能学会。


准备工作:你需要这些东西


在写代码之前,咱们得先有个能写代码、运行代码的地方,也就是编译器。新手的话,兔子哥推荐用 Dev-C++,安装简单,界面也不复杂,很适合入门。
要是你还没安装,可以先去官网下载一个,安装的时候一路点 “下一步” 就行,记得选个自己好找的文件夹装,比如 D 盘的 “C 语言工具” 文件夹里,这样以后想找也方便。安装好后,双击图标打开,看到一个蓝色的界面,就说明准备工作做好了。


编写第一个代码的详细步骤


咱们就写最经典的 “Hello World” 程序吧,几乎每个学编程的人,第一个代码都是它,简单又有代表性。
  1. 新建源代码文件
    打开 Dev-C++ 后,点左上角的 “文件”,然后选 “新建”,再点 “源代码”。这时候,你会看到一个白色的编辑区,这就是咱们写代码的地方了。
  2. 输入代码
    在编辑区里,输入下面这些代码:
    #include
    int main ()
    {
    printf ("Hello World!\n");
    return 0;
    }
    输的时候别着急,慢慢输,注意括号和分号都是英文状态下的,中文的括号和分号电脑可不认识。

  3. 保存文件
    代码输完了,得保存一下,不然关掉软件就没了。点 “文件”,选 “保存”,弹出一个窗口让你选保存位置。你可以在刚才装软件的文件夹里,新建一个 “我的第一个代码” 文件夹,然后给文件起个名字,比如 “hello.c”。这里要注意,文件名后面必须加 “.c”,这是 C 语言文件的标志,不加的话,电脑不知道这是个 C 语言代码文件。



运行代码,看看效果


代码写好了,也保存了,接下来就是让它跑起来,看看能不能显示出咱们想要的内容。
  1. 编译代码
    点菜单栏里的 “运行”,然后选 “编译”,或者直接按 F9。这一步是让电脑检查代码有没有错误,把代码翻译成电脑能看懂的语言。如果下面的信息栏显示 “编译成功”,就说明代码没问题;要是有错误,会提示你哪里错了,比如少了个分号,这时候你就回去看看,改过来再重新编译。
  2. 运行代码
    编译成功后,点 “运行” 里的 “运行”,或者按 F10。这时候会弹出一个黑色的窗口,里面显示着 “Hello World!”,恭喜你,你的第一个 C 语言代码成功运行了!

可能有小白会问,这个黑色窗口一闪就没了咋办?别担心,那是因为代码运行完了就自动关了。你可以在 “return 0;” 前面加一行 “system ("pause");”,记得还要在最上面加 “#include ”,这样窗口就会停住,让你看清楚结果了。


代码看不懂?别急,兔子哥给你解释


可能你会说,代码是输进去了,也运行了,但那些字母和符号到底啥意思啊?咱们一句一句来看:
  • #include :这句话就像告诉电脑,“我要用 stdio.h 这个工具箱里的东西啦”,这个工具箱里有打印文字的功能,后面的 printf 就靠它呢。
  • int main ():main 是 “主要” 的意思,这个是程序的入口,电脑会从这里开始执行代码,就像咱们走路要从起点开始一样。
  • { }:这两个大括号里的内容,就是 main 函数要做的事情,相当于一个范围。
  • printf ("Hello World!\n"):printf 是 “打印” 的意思,就是让电脑在屏幕上显示出双引号里的内容,“\n” 是换行的意思,让文字后面空出一行。
  • return 0;:表示程序正常结束了,告诉电脑 “我跑完啦,没问题”。



常见问题及解决办法


可能遇到的问题原因解决办法
编译时提示 “未定义的标识符 printf”没加 #include 在代码最上面加上这句话
保存后文件图标不对,不是 C 语言文件文件名没加.c 后缀重新保存,确保文件名是 “xxx.c”
运行后窗口一闪而过程序运行太快,自动关闭了按前面说的,加 system ("pause") 和对应的头文件



兔子哥当初学 C 语言的时候,写第一个代码也犯了不少错,要么是把分号写成中文的,要么是忘了保存就运行,折腾了好一会儿才成功。其实啊,新手犯错很正常,关键是别怕,错了就看提示,一点点改,改着改着就熟练了。
写第一个代码,重要的不是代码有多难,而是熟悉整个流程,从新建文件、写代码,到保存、编译、运行,每一步都清楚了,以后学更复杂的代码就有底气了。所以,别嫌简单,一定要亲手写一遍,看着那个黑色窗口里出现 “Hello World!” 的时候,你会觉得特别有成就感。加油,小白也能变成编程高手!

标签: Hello World 文件夹

发布评论 0条评论)

  • Refresh code

还木有评论哦,快来抢沙发吧~